301 redirect vseh strani?

Lep pozdrav,

moja stran debate-motions.info je že nekaj časa preseljena in prejšnji server ni omogočakl htaccess, tako da je sh404 rewrite deloval preko dodajanja index.php v vsak naslov. Torej smo imeli naslove debate-motions.info/index.php/karkoli. Stran je sedaj preseljena in ima htaccess, tako da je iz vseh spletnih naslovov odvzet index.php, torej imamo spletne naslove debate-motions.info/karkoli.
Seveda je google čisto znorel, ko so se vsi naslovi spletnih strani spremenili (in jaz nisem ravno razmišljal ter sem pričakoval da bo komponenta za rewritanje naslovov to sama uredila.) in tako javlja tisoče 404 strani, izginili so sitelinki ipd.
A obstaja kakšen rewrite, ki bi preusmeril vse stare strani na nove? Na DP forumu so mi predlagali:
RewriteEngine On
RewriteBase /
RewriteCond %{REQUESTFILENAME} !-f
RewriteCond %{REQUEST
FILENAME} !-d
RewriteRule ^index.php/(.*)$ $1
Vendar stvar ne deluje, verjetno tudi zaradi že obstoječega htaccessa, ki že prepisuje spletne naslove.
Kakšna ideja, kaj lahko naredim?

Tnx

13 odgovorov

Jah no, to bi bilo nekoliko preveč zapleteno zame. Očitno bomo pač preživeli to sr, pa se jeseni vrnili boljši in bolj pametni :D

Google zdaj omogoča prenos iz ene domene na drugo. Poglej v nov webmasters vmesnik. Seveda je pogoj 301 redirect, pa lepo je če je prenos strani 1:1 (prenos vseh strani).

vem ja, ampak to je čisto druga stvar...